Planning for Your Paint Job



Before you dive into your paint project, it's essential to take a few primary steps to make sure every little thing goes efficiently.

Begin by evaluating the condition of the surface areas you'll be paint. Try to find any type of damages, mold, or peeling paint that requires repair service.

Next off, gather your devices and materials, including brushes, rollers, tape, and drop cloths. Clear the location around your work space to prevent accidents and protect surrounding property.

Finally, check the weather prediction; excellent conditions are important for an effective paint work.

Employing the Right Professionals



Discovering the right contractors for your industrial exterior painting project can make all the difference in achieving a specialist coating. Beginning by researching neighborhood business with solid online reputations. Inspect on the internet evaluations and request referrals from various other business owners.

Don't neglect to ask about their experience with industrial tasks comparable to your own. Verify their licensing and insurance to shield on your own from possible obligations.



Finally, trust your instincts-- pick a service provider who connects well and makes you feel confident about their abilities. Taking the time to work with the appropriate group will certainly pay off with magnificent outcomes.
